Output 451675c9e1460b62ee999d5a3de470145e087be2a2bf88b3dca2e439009b0dca:1

value
25762152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a8856305d9c4d5dfe738935c95a3ecbf4ab46d OP_EQUALVERIFY OP_CHECKSIG
address
13FP6emhDbAhEbxpavshPKDEZ7cj22aBgY
transaction
451675c9e1460b62ee999d5a3de470145e087be2a2bf88b3dca2e439009b0dca
spent
true